Mark Zuckerberg said he considered drop-off ‘normal’ and expected retention to grow as the company adds more features, including desktop version and search functionality.
Currently, there are no ads on the Threads app and Zuckerberg said the company would only think about monetization once there was a clear path to 1 billion users.
Christine Pai, the company's representative, said in an email statement that Threads will not be fact-checked. This eliminates Meta's other apps' misinformation monitoring feature.
